U.S. patent number D714,162 [Application Number D/427,711] was granted by the patent office on 2014-09-30 for bottle combined with cap having internal martini glass. The grantee listed for this patent is Julie Stevens Kang. Invention is credited to Julie Stevens Kang.

Description



FIG. 1 is a perspective view of a bottle combined with cap having internal martini glass, showing my new design;

FIG. 2 is an exploded perspective view thereof;

FIG. 3 is a front elevational view thereof, the rear elevational view, left-side elevational view, and right-side elevational view all being a mirror image thereof;

FIG. 4 is a top plan view thereof, the bottom plan view being a mirror image thereof; and,

FIG. 5 is a cross-sectional view thereof, taken along lines 5-5 of FIG. 4.

It is understood that apart from the threads of the cap and the bottle, the design is radially symettric such that cross-sectional views across any diameter are, apart from the threads, identical.
